What is the future of LED lighting ?

The future of LED lighting holds promising advancements driven by ongoing research and technological innovation. LED technology continues to evolve with a focus on improving efficiency, longevity, and versatility in various applications. Future developments are likely to enhance energy efficiency even further, making LED lighting more cost-effective and environmentally friendly compared to traditional lighting technologies like incandescent and fluorescent bulbs. Innovations in materials and manufacturing processes may also lead to brighter LEDs with improved color rendering capabilities, expanding their use in residential, commercial, and industrial settings.

While LEDs have dominated the lighting market for their energy efficiency and durability, ongoing research explores alternative technologies that could complement or enhance LED lighting. Emerging technologies such as OLED (Organic Light-Emitting Diode) lighting present a potential future alternative. OLEDs offer thin, flexible panels that emit light across their surfaces, enabling unique lighting designs and applications. Although currently more expensive and less efficient than LEDs for general lighting, OLEDs hold promise for specialized applications where their thin form factor and design flexibility are advantageous.

The future of lighting technology is expected to include advancements that improve overall efficiency, control, and user experience. Innovations in smart lighting systems represent a significant development. These systems integrate LEDs with networked controls, sensors, and software to enable automated lighting adjustments based on occupancy, daylight levels, and user preferences. Smart lighting technologies not only enhance energy efficiency but also offer personalized lighting environments, contributing to comfort, productivity, and sustainability in homes, offices, and public spaces.

Recent advancements in LED lighting technology focus on enhancing performance and functionality. One notable development is the integration of Internet of Things (IoT) capabilities into LED fixtures. IoT-enabled LED lighting systems can communicate with other devices and systems, allowing for sophisticated control and monitoring capabilities. This integration supports energy optimization, predictive maintenance, and customization of lighting environments based on real-time data and user preferences. Such advancements are paving the way for smarter, more adaptive lighting solutions that meet evolving demands in various sectors.

The future of smart lighting is poised for growth as technology continues to advance. Smart lighting systems are expected to become more intuitive and interconnected, offering enhanced functionality and efficiency. Future trends include the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) for advanced lighting control, predictive analytics to optimize energy usage, and seamless integration with smart home and building automation systems. These advancements are set to transform how lighting is managed and experienced, providing greater flexibility, energy savings, and improved quality of life for users.
